A sew-in weave is a type of hair extension that is sewn onto your natural hair using a needle and thread. The weave can be made from human hair, synthetic hair, or a combination of both. Sew-in weaves are typically used to add length, volume, or color to your natural hair. Leave-out is a technique used in sew-in weaves where a portion of your natural hair is left out of the weave. This allows you to blend your natural hair with the weave for a more natural look.

Sew-in weaves with leave-out have many benefits. They can help you to achieve a variety of different looks, from sleek and sophisticated to voluminous and glamorous. Sew-in weaves can also help to protect your natural hair from damage caused by heat styling and other harsh treatments. Additionally, sew-in weaves are a relatively low-maintenance style, which can save you time and money in the long run.

If you are considering getting a sew-in weave with leave-out, it is important to consult with a professional hair stylist to discuss your individual needs and goals. Your stylist can help you to choose the right type of weave and leave-out technique for your hair type and desired look.

Sew-in weaves with leave-out offer significant protection for natural hair, particularly from the damaging effects of heat styling and other harsh treatments. Heat styling tools, such as flat irons and blow dryers, can cause hair to become dry, brittle, and prone to breakage. Chemical treatments, such as relaxers and perms, can also damage hair by altering its structure. Sew-in weaves act as a barrier between natural hair and these damaging elements, reducing the risk of breakage and other forms of damage.

In addition to protecting hair from heat and chemical damage, sew-in weaves can also provide protection from environmental factors, such as UV rays and pollution. These factors can contribute to hair damage and dryness, but sew-in weaves can help to shield hair from these elements.

The protective benefits of sew-in weaves with leave-out make them a valuable option for those who want to maintain healthy, natural hair. By reducing the risk of damage, sew-in weaves can help hair to grow longer, stronger, and healthier.

The longevity of sew-in weaves with leave-out is a significant factor contributing to their popularity. Proper care and maintenance are essential to ensure the longevity of the weave and the health of your natural hair.

  • Regular Cleansing and Conditioning: To maintain a healthy scalp and prevent product buildup, regular cleansing and conditioning are crucial. Use sulfate-free products specifically designed for sew-in weaves to avoid damaging the hair or the weave.
  • Gentle Detangling: Detangling the hair gently is essential to prevent breakage and tangles. Use a wide-tooth comb or a detangling brush, starting from the ends and working your way up to the roots.
  • Avoid Excessive Manipulation: Minimize brushing and combing to prevent unnecessary shedding and tangling. When styling, opt for low-manipulation techniques to preserve the integrity of the weave.
  • Protective Styling at Night: To reduce friction and prevent tangles while sleeping, use a satin pillowcase or wear a silk scarf or bonnet.

By observing these care and maintenance tips, you can extend the lifespan of your sew-in weave with leave-out, ensuring it remains beautiful and healthy-looking for weeks to come.

Question 1: How long do sew-in weaves with leave-out typically last?

The longevity of sew-in weaves with leave-out depends on factors such as hair type, maintenance routine, and the skill of the hairstylist. With proper care, they can last for several weeks, offering a versatile and protective styling option.

Question 2: Can sew-in weaves with leave-out damage my natural hair?

When installed and maintained correctly, sew-in weaves with leave-out can protect natural hair from damage. They reduce the need for heat styling and other harsh treatments that can weaken hair. However, improper installation or excessive tension can lead to breakage.

Question 3: How often should I wash my hair with a sew-in weave with leave-out?

The frequency of washing depends on your scalp and hair type. Regular cleansing is essential to maintain scalp health and prevent product buildup. Consult with your hairstylist for personalized advice based on your individual needs.

Question 4: Can I style my sew-in weave with leave-out using heat tools?

While heat styling can be used on sew-in weaves with leave-out, it's important to exercise caution to avoid damaging the hair. Use low heat settings and heat protectant sprays to minimize the risk of breakage or dryness.

Question 5: How do I maintain my leave-out to blend seamlessly with my natural hair?

To blend your leave-out seamlessly, regular touch-ups are essential. This involves trimming split ends and maintaining the length and texture of your natural hair to match the weave. Additionally, using products designed for natural hair can help enhance the blend.

Question 6: Are sew-in weaves with leave-out suitable for all hair types?

Sew-in weaves with leave-out are versatile and can be customized to suit various hair types. However, it's important to consult with a professional hairstylist to determine the most appropriate installation method and hair texture for your specific hair type.

Tips for Sew-In Weaves with Leave-Out

Incorporating a sew-in weave with leave-out into your hair care routine requires careful consideration and proper techniques. Here are some valuable tips to ensure a successful and beneficial experience:

Tip 1: Consultation and Customization: Prior to installation, consult with a professional hairstylist to determine the most suitable hair type, length, and texture for your natural hair. This personalized approach ensures a harmonious blend and minimizes the risk of damage.

Tip 2: Protective Installation: Proper installation is paramount. Ensure that the weave is securely attached without causing excessive tension on your natural hair. This protective approach prevents breakage and promotes the health of your scalp.

Tip 3: Regular Maintenance: Regular maintenance is essential to preserve the longevity and beauty of your sew-in weave with leave-out. Adhere to a consistent washing and conditioning routine using products specifically designed for extensions.

Tip 4: Gentle Detangling: When detangling your hair, use a wide-tooth comb or a detangling brush to minimize breakage. Start from the ends and gently work your way up to the roots, avoiding excessive force.

Tip 5: Heat Styling with Caution: While heat styling tools can be used on sew-in weaves with leave-out, exercise caution to prevent damage. Employ low heat settings and utilize heat protectant sprays to safeguard the hair.

Tip 6: Protective Styling at Night: To prevent tangles and reduce friction while sleeping, opt for protective hairstyles such as braids or buns. Additionally, a satin pillowcase or a silk scarf can further minimize hair damage.

By following these tips, you can reap the benefits of a sew-in weave with leave-out while maintaining the health and beauty of your natural hair.
